Compare Aurora to Morton Grove

This post compares Aurora, Illinois to Morton Grove, Illinois across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Aurora (city) Morton Grove (village)
Population 200,946 23,391
Income (median) $44,325 $57,421
Home Value (median) $170,800 $290,500
White 56% 63%
Black 10% 3%
Asian 8% 29%
With Kids 45% 27%
Age (median) 32 47
Rentals 35% 7%
